My Daughters name is Cinya Pinks, she was born prematurely January 20th, 2021. I had her at 31 weeks and two days. I just recently lost my son, Chancelor Pinks, he was born prematurely with collapsed lungs on March 18th, 2020; he passed away shortly after. His father and I were still healing from his loss while remaining hopeful that our baby girl would arrive healthy with no complications when we recently found out that his condition was reccouring in my second pregnancy with Cinya. Exactly one week before her birth, abnormalities were discovered on an ultrasound so we were sent to meet with several medical professionals that specialize in high risk pregnancies, fetal diagnostics, genetics, and neonatology in Iowa city just one day before she was unexpectedly delivered . The doctors in Iowa city are working diligently to care for her as we’ve learned so much about her in these last 3 months , her diagnosis is called GDLN which is extremely rare and ultimately has no blue print, we’re all just following Cinyas lead. On top of her diagnosis we are also dealing with issues related to her being premature. Today (4/21/21) she’s getting a tracheostomy and Gtube surgery to give her a different more secure location for support with her breathing since it’s believed that she will need breathing support for up to 2 years of her life. At the minimum, we have up to 4 months left at the hospital before she gets to come home.


My greatest wish is for myself and her father is to be able to be by our daughters side as she continues to fight for her life. Her lungs are in much better condition then they were when she got here, but she does have a chronic lung disease that makes all of her obstacles a little more challenging to conquer and they require more time. Miraculously she has shown so much progress and has exceeded the expectations that were talked about for her. Over the course of these next 4 months we will be being trained on how to care for her and meet all of her needs as she will be coming home with an at home ventilator. This means her father and I will not be able to be employed for roughly 4 months if not more.
